  ABOUT ST. MICHAEL SCHOOL

St. Michael is a small community school situated in the vicinity of the hospitals. The school is located in a quiet residential area with trees and bush surrounding the playground. The school has a population of 106 students. There are 6 classes from JK to grade 6, including a Communication Class. Along with the classroom teachers, the support staff consists of a principal, a secretary, a Core French teacher, Itinerant teachers, an Educational Assistant and a custodian. St. Michael the Archangel, is represented on our crest and we are known as “The St. Michael Spirits”. The staff and students are familiar with all their peers and an atmosphere of care and concern prevails.

St. Michael School benefits from the participation of volunteers in the school. Students from Cambrian College, Laurentian University and St. Benedict’s Catholic Secondary School help out on a regular basis. Also, the library is maintained by three parent volunteers. Volunteers are also evident on special occasions such as hot dog days, field trips, play days, to name a few. Teachers supervise noon hour sports and coach various sports teams (ie., volley-ball, soccer). Mrs. Udeschini, another parent-volunteer, conducts dance classes twice a week during the lunch hour recess and Mrs. Henry directs the junior choir.

Mass and prayer services are held in our school gym on a regular basis. We are blessed to have Father Tony from Christ the King Church celebrate mass with us. He also visits with students and staff and we look forward to seeing him.

The community is also involved. Three times a week, the gym is used for exercise classes. The grade 5/6 class was involved with the V.I.P.- Values, Influences and Peers Program with the Sudbury Regional Police and the Self-esteem workshop presented by the Sudbury & District Health Unit. We are part of the “Healthy Schools” Program and we benefit from the many services offered by the staff at the Sudbury &District Health Unit. Presentations have been given by staff from Laurentian University, Sudbury Hydro, the Art Gallery , a lawyer, Big Brothers Association and the Laurentian Lake Conservation staff.


The St. Michael Catholic School Council is very active. In the past they have endorsed the Code of Behaviour , wrote a vision statement along with the by-laws. Presently the Council is concerned about the St. Michael school playground. As it has been past practice for the last 8 years, the Council is busy working on the St. Michael Christmas Market, held every November. This is a major fundraiser for our school.

St. Michael School is very vibrant and positive. This is evident from the range of initiatives in which the school is involved. This vibrancy is also evident in the activities at the school. Students are eager to be nominated for the “Caught You Being Good” award and the “Student of the Month” awards. There are also various activities in which our students participate: Topper’s Pizza “Feed Your Mind” Program, Chess Club, Floor Hockey, Beachball Volleyball, Track & Field, etc.

We have also entered a number of events. Last year St. Michael’s School won the “Most Improved” award for the Sudbury Catholic District School Board’s Math Challenge competition. This school year, some classes will participate in the Regional Heritage Fair. Other students have been recognized for their artistic work.
